圖形使用者介面(GUI)是現代電腦互動的核心,它以直觀友好的圖形方式簡化了使用者與電腦的互動。從早期的文字命令列到現今觸控螢幕的普及,GUI 的發展歷程見證了電腦科技的快速進步,也深刻改變了人們的生活方式。 Downcodes小編將帶您深入了解GUI 的發展、組成、使用者體驗及當代應用,希望能幫助您更能理解這項關鍵技術。
GUI在網路用語中通常指「圖形使用者介面」(Graphical User Interface),這是讓電腦使用者可以透過圖形圖示和視覺指示進行互動的介面類型。而在電腦科學領域它作為一個重要的概念,提供了使用者與電子設備之間的直接互動方式,大大簡化了操作難度、提高了工作效率。圖形使用者介面利用視覺元素來表示電腦作業系統中的各種功能和操作,透過滑鼠點擊、觸控或鍵盤輸入等方式實現使用者與系統的互動。
圖形使用者介面的發展對個人電腦的普及具有重要意義,它使得非技術人員也能輕鬆使用複雜的電腦系統。在GUI出現之前,計算機使用者需要透過命令列介面以文字命令來控制計算機,這要求使用者必須記住大量命令和語法規則,對於普通使用者來說既困難又不便利。
在GUI出現之前,所有的使用者操作都必須透過文字命令實現,使用者需要學習具體的指令並在命令列介面中輸入它們來進行操作。儘管它對熟練用戶來說可以實現快速精確的控制,但卻對新手不夠友善。
圖形使用者介面的概念最早是在1960年代末期由史丹佛研究院及後來的Xerox PARC實驗室開發的。其中,Xerox Star是最早使用商業圖形介面的電腦之一。但GUI真正進入大眾視野是在1984年,蘋果公司發布了其Macintosh電腦,它提供了一個完整的圖形介面,並帶有滑鼠和視窗。
隨後,微軟公司推出了Windows作業系統,它所搭載的圖形使用者介面促進了PC電腦的普及,並逐漸成為市場的主導。 Windows透過不斷的刷新和升級GUI,讓作業系統更加美觀易用。
圖形使用者介面由多個關鍵組成部分構成,包括視窗、圖示、選單、指標和小工具等。使用者透過這些元素與電腦系統進行交雲。
視窗是GUI環境中的基本元素,它是螢幕上可以包含使用者與程式互動元素的矩形區域。使用者可以開啟、關閉、最大化、最小化和移動窗口,以及在多個窗口間切換來進行多任務操作。
圖示是表示程式、文件、功能或指令的小圖形,使用者可以透過雙擊或拖曳圖示來執行特定的操作。圖示的使用在GUI中非常普遍,因為它們能直覺地展示操作對象,讓使用者快速辨識。
選單以清單形式歸納和展示了可用的命令和選項,使用者可以透過選擇選單項目來執行操作。選單通常包括頂層選單(如文件、編輯等)和上下文選單(右鍵點擊物件時出現的選單)。
指標是使用者在螢幕上進行導航和選擇的圖形表示,通常呈現為一個小箭頭,它會跟隨滑鼠的移動而移動。而遊標則常出現在文字操作場景,提示使用者目前輸入的位置。
小工具(也稱為控製或元件)是完成特定功能的互動元素,如按鈕、滑桿、文字方塊等。使用者透過與這些小工具互動來控製程式的不同部分和功能。
GUI的設計對於優化使用者體驗至關重要,一個良好的圖形使用者介面能夠使用戶的操作更加直覺、快速且愉悅。 GUI的使用者體驗是其最突出的優勢之一。
GUI使得操作和程式功能的可見性大大增強,使用者可以直接從螢幕上看到可用的選項和命令,並透過簡單的點擊和選擇來進行操作,無需記憶複雜的命令列指令。
互動設計是GUI不可或缺的一部分,使用者可以透過直接與介面元素互動來獲得即時回饋。這種互動性使得學習和使用電腦更加容易,並提高了使用者的工作效率。
GUI的可自訂性允許使用者個性化他們的操作環境,包括改變主題、背景、顏色方案等。同時,現代GUI在視覺設計上也更加精美,增強了使用者的視覺享受。
為了讓殘疾人士或其他有特殊需求的使用者也能有效地使用計算機,現代GUI通常會整合輔助功能,如語音辨識、螢幕閱讀器、放大鏡等。這些功能保證了GUI的普適設計概念。
GUI在當代技術中的應用已經遠遠超出了最初的個人電腦,它現在被廣泛應用於各種數位設備和應用中。在行動互聯網和智慧型裝置的背景下,GUI設計正在不斷革新和擴展。
智慧型手機和平板電腦的作業系統,如iOS和Android,都採用了高度最佳化的GUI。這些行動作業系統的圖形使用者介面不僅易於使用,而且充分考慮到了觸控操作的便利性和直覺性。
隨著物聯網技術的發展,GUI已經被應用到智慧家庭的管理系統。透過觸控螢幕或智慧型裝置的介面,使用者可以輕鬆控製家中的燈光、溫度、安全監控等設施。
1. 什麼是GUI(圖形使用者介面)?
GUI是一種網路用語,全稱為圖形使用者介面。它是一種透過圖形元素,如按鈕、選單等,以及滑鼠和鍵盤的互動來操作電腦的介面。相較於傳統的文字介面,GUI更直覺且易於使用,適合一般使用者操作。在現代網路應用中,GUI已成為常見的介面形式。
2. GUI在網路應用中的重要性是什麼?
GUI在網路應用中扮演了至關重要的角色。它使用戶能夠透過圖形化的介面與應用程式進行交互,使得操作更加直觀、簡單,並且省去了記憶複雜命令的麻煩。透過GUI,使用者可以輕鬆完成各種任務,例如發送電子郵件、瀏覽網頁、編輯文件等。因此,在設計網路應用時,重視GUI的友善性和易用性對於使用者體驗至關重要。
3. 什麼是Web GUI(網路圖形使用者介面)?
Web GUI指的是基於網頁的圖形使用者介面。它使用HTML、CSS和JavaScript等技術來創建互動式的圖形元素,透過網頁瀏覽器來呈現給使用者。 Web GUI在網路應用中使用廣泛,可讓使用者直接在瀏覽器中完成各種操作,而無需額外的軟體安裝。它具有跨平台性和可訪問性的特點,可以在不同的設備上以相似的方式提供使用者介面。
希望Downcodes小編的講解能幫助您對GUI有一個全面的認識。 GUI 的未來發展將持續朝著更智慧、更個人化、更容易用的方向發展,為使用者帶來更便利、更愉悅的數位體驗。